java.lang.ProcessBuilder 類用於建立作業系統進程。此類是不同步的。
以下是java.lang.ProcessBuilder類的宣告:
public final class ProcessBuilder extends Object
S.N. | 建構函式 & 描述 |
---|---|
1 |
ProcessBuilder(List<String> command) 此構造一個進程生成器指定的作業系統程式和引數。 |
2 |
ProcessBuilder(String... command) 此構造一個進程生成器指定的作業系統程式和引數。 |
S.N. | 方法 & 描述 |
---|---|
1 |
List<String> command() 此方法返回此進程生成器的作業系統程式和引數。 |
2 |
ProcessBuilder command(List<String> command) 此方法設定此進程生成器的作業系統程式和引數。 |
3 |
ProcessBuilder command(String... command) 此方法設定此進程生成器的作業系統程式和引數。 |
4 |
File directory() 此方法返回此進程生成器的工作目錄。 |
5 |
ProcessBuilder directory(File directory) 此方法設定此進程生成器的工作目錄。 |
6 |
Map<String,String> environment() 此方法返回此進程生成器環境的字串對映檢視。 |
7 |
boolean redirectErrorStream() 這個方法告訴此進程生成器是否合併標準錯誤和標準輸出。 |
8 |
ProcessBuilder redirectErrorStream(boolean redirectErrorStream) 此方法設定此進程生成器redirectErrorStream的屬性。 |
9 |
Process start() 這種方法使用此進程生成器的屬性一個新的進程。 |
這個類從以下類繼承的方法:
java.lang.Object